    The measurements on the canner inside pot are for cooking food when pressure cooking meats or steaming vegetables or rice. For pressure canning its always 8 cups water using a measuring vessel.

    I lost my instructions on how to use THIS canner... and I'm a new to canning. Can you give me some direction on the vent positions to start? Is it open to build pressure or off. Any instructions will put me in business! TY so much. I'm lost!

    • @LoganStyles21
      @LoganStyles21 4 года назад +2

      Set your valve to exhaust leave it there canner will start to blow up steam and display E10 wait for the 10 minute countdown to E0 maschine will beep 3 times than flip to airtight. Make sure you use correct valve for you location altitude. Check if you need black valve at 10 pound pressure or green valve at 15 pound pressure.
